Ms. Sheila Marie
Caption: Ms. Sheila Marie
Actress Source: IMDB Sheila Leason is an actress, known for Pitchfork (2016) and FightZone Presents (2007).
Leslie Nielsen pictures →
Stacy Lockhart pictures →
Maree O'Sullivan pictures →